Answer:

(-1, -3)

Step-by-step explanation:

The solution of the graph is the coordinate of the point where the two lines intercept each other on the graph.

Thus, the two lines intercept at when x = -1, y = -3.

The solution to the system of equations represented on the graph would be (-1, -3)
